Blueberry Smoothie Recipe Without Yogurt
This blueberry smoothie recipe is perfect for those looking for a dairy-free option. It’s quick, nutritious, and delicious, providing a rich source of antioxidants and vitamins. The smoothie is creamy without yogurt, making it suitable for lactose-intolerant individuals, vegans, or anyone looking to try a dairy-free alternative. It’s packed with blueberries, banana, and plant-based milk to give you a healthy boost in just 10 minutes.

- ¾ cup frozen blueberries
- 1 cup non-dairy milk like almond, oat, or coconut
- 1 ripe banana
- 1 tablespoon chia seeds
- Optional Add-ins for Enhanced Nutrition
- 1 scoop plant-based protein powder
- 1 tablespoon almond butter
- Handful of spinach
- 1 tablespoon old-fashioned oats
- Ingredient Substitutions for Dietary Needs
- Frozen Blueberries → Mixed Berries
- Almond Milk → Oat Milk
- Chia Seeds → Flax Seeds
Pour ½ cup unsweetened almond milk into the blender.
Add organic greens powder (optional).
Include frozen blueberries and 1 ripe banana.
Blend on high for 30-60 seconds, using the pulse function for stubborn chunks.
Pour into a glass and enjoy!

- Use frozen fruits for a creamy, thick texture.
- Adjust the liquid-to-solid ratios to find your preferred texture.
- You can add more protein by including plant-based protein powder, chia seeds, or nut butter.
- If you prefer a thicker smoothie, use avocado, protein powder, or extra frozen fruit.
